Output e53ab323d68d7ccb7106a63fe2e72d39877c41ae8563f5bb21fd9b9f666f36c6:0

value
12920594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e009db3c03b71ff527c46d7c6154b3509a5724 OP_EQUAL
address
3Lv2DJ8RAFSswBb9RevyQvyA9JGfr6zp2i
transaction
e53ab323d68d7ccb7106a63fe2e72d39877c41ae8563f5bb21fd9b9f666f36c6
spent
true